Source: Wisdom Library: Local Names of Plants and DrugsNilofar [نیلوفر] in the Urdu language is the name of a plant identified with Nymphaea alba L. from the Nymphaeaceae (Waterlily) family having the following synonyms: Castalia alba, Nymphaea venusta, Nymphaea splendens. Source: Google Books: CRC World Dictionary (Regional names)1) Nilofar in India is the name of a plant defined with Nymphaea capensis in various botanical sources. This page contains potential references in Ayurveda, modern medicine, and other folk traditions or local practices It has the synonym Nymphaea bernierana Planch. (among others).
2) Nilofar is also identified with Nymphaea lotus It has the synonym Castalia mystica Salisb. (etc.).
